Transaction 80bb31b199c9fe45a613a19f1f3fa940ae71aa0b46c2fdb0699aa1525c0077e9

1 Input
2 Outputs
  • 80bb31b199c9fe45a613a19f1f3fa940ae71aa0b46c2fdb0699aa1525c0077e9:0
  • value  1035782
    address  3FeEGEFTJKLurqox7E3eCxAeCGA6abkb17
  • 80bb31b199c9fe45a613a19f1f3fa940ae71aa0b46c2fdb0699aa1525c0077e9:1
  • value  62621
    address  3CVxcx4R5o5JEcAEzqxHxYPLEK74FowDu8